Etymology

[edit]

Compound of paleis (palace) and kwartier (quarter, neighbourhood). The neighbourhood's streets are named after various terms related to palace architecture.

Proper noun

[edit]

Paleiskwartier n

  1. A neighbourhood of 's-Hertogenbosch, Noord-Brabant, Netherlands.
